What Are Synthetic Sponges Made Out Of. Web synthetic sponges can be made of polyester, polyurethane, or vegetable cellulose. Flax and other ingredients are added to certain formulations for durability, chemical resistance, or other benefits. Web while it is true that real sea sponges have been in use since the roman empire, synthetic alternatives made primarily from wood pulp became commonplace by the middle of the 20th century when dupont perfected the process of manufacturing them.
